LINCOLN ELEMENTARY is a public elementary serving grades 3–5 in SAINT CLOUD, Minnesota. The school enrolls 295 students. It is part of the ST. CLOUD PUBLIC SCHOOL DISTRICT district.

Equity & Title I
In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
